THE RACING DESCRIBED.

BY TELEGRAPH—SPECIAL TO THE STARWELLINGTON, Jan. 24. The Wellington meeting was concluded to-dav in fine -weather, the tiack being very fast. _ „ . Vesperus wound up a very good lavourite for the Wallacevillo High-weight. Son o ’ Mine led out from Oriflamb, Tanadiee and Lady Passenger, 'with. Bennanee and Ardfinnan last. At the six furlongs post Oriflamb had taken charge from Son o ’ Mine, Wedding March and Tannadiee,, with Capitulation and Vesperus last. Capitulation had gone up second to Oriflamb crossing the top with No Favours, Wedding March and Son o' Mine next. Wedding March ran up to Oriflamb and Capitulation at tho false rails, where No Favours was under punishment. Wedding March went on to beat Capitulation by a head, with Vesperus, finishing fast, a neck away third. No Favours, Son o’ Mine, Oriflamb and Ardfinnan were next.

Stormy was a hot favourite for the Kelburn Handicap, but his backers were soon out of suspense, for he almost fell over at the barrier and lost about ten lengths. Royal Game, Jemidar and Gardant led out from Kilmiss, but passing the six furlongs barrier Jemidar, Royal Game and Gardant led Mountain Tod, with Assurance six lengths from the leaders and Stormy another three lengths away last. At the turn Gardant, Jemidar and Royal Game led Outfit, Kilmiss and Assurance with Stormy up with the field. Assurance ana Kilmiss drew out in the straight, Assurance winning by half a length from Kilmiss, with Outfit four lengths away. Stormy was fourth and Jemidar and Some Lad next. Stormy was a certainty beaten. High Finance was a decided favourite for tho Hopeful Stakes. Melissa, Laity, Auratum, Reckless and Silver Coot appeared to begin best, but racing on to the course proper Silver Coot led Melissa and Reckless with Wild Pigeon n n d Laity most forward of the others. Silver Coot drew ajvay at the end to beat Melissa by two and a half lengths, with Laity half a length away third. High Finance was fourth and''Chips, Priceless, Sudden Storm and Reckless next.

Horomea wound up favourite for the Melrose Handicap in a great betting race. Hymill led out from Horomea, Crossbow, Serotina and Starboard Light and Bronstell. Hymill led across the top from Horomea, Serotina, Starboard Light, Bronstell, Crossbow, and Battle Colours. At the turn HymUl still led from Starboard Light, Serotina, Horomea and Battle Colours. Black Mint and Gold Mint made a belated appearance in the straight and, running past the leaders, Black Mint beat Gold Mint by a head. Hymill was half a length away third, with Mister Gamp, Starboard Light and Horomea next. Run in 1.275. SUMMER SURPRISES. In the Summer Handicap, Grand Knight carried a few tickets more than

Reremoana in a good betting race. The Hawk, Rascal, Deluge and Grand Knight began best and, at the end of a furlong, Deluge led Joy King, First Acre, Rascal, Centrepiece and Grand Knight, with Reremoana last. Crossing the top Deluge led Rascal, Centrepiece, Grand Knight and Penman. Racing for the turn Rascal and Deluge were still in front from Centrepiece, Penman, Grand Knight, The Hawk and First Acre. Centrepiece went across and interfered with Grand Knight at the false rail, where First Acre came through. Centrepiece and First Acre were joined 100 yards from homo by Grand Knight and, in a great battle to the post, Centrepiece beat First Acre by a head, with Grand Knight half a length away third. The Hawk was fourth and Inferno, Reremoana and Rascal were next. In the Consolation Handicap, Hynanna and Civility had a good battle for favouritism, Hynanna winding up with the honours and there being good money for Clarinda and Front Rank. Civility, Clarinda and Alloway began best with Mandane and Front Rank running off the course at the turn, Front Rank being ridden hard. Alloway was in front at the mile post from Civility, Royal Mint, Mandane, Clarinda and Perle de Leon. Crossing the top, Front Rank and Mandane led Civility, Alloway, Royal Mint and Clarinda with Hynanna last. At the turn, Front Rank and Mandane led Alloway, Civility, Clarinda, Royal Mint and Hynanna. The last named ran to the front at the false rail and, going on, won easily by two lengths from Civility. Clarinda was two and a half lengths away third and Mandane, Perle de Leon, Alloway and Fresco came next. Shirley, High Pitch and Mimetic carried the bulk of the money in the City Handicap. Nadarino, Shirley, High Pitch and Booster began best. Racing on to the course, proper, Corn Money led Shirley, Booster and Benzora, with High Pitch handy. Shirley stayed on to beat Benzora by half a length, with Booster half a length away third. Corn Money was fourth and Receipt and High-Hitch next.

In the concluding event the betting took a wide range. Dimmer, Royal Tractor, Sagittarius, Lady Ideal, Aston and Folly led on to the course proper, where Lady Ideal petered out and Aston came through with Bank Note and Orazone. Crown Area then appeared and going on beat Aston by a length, with Orazone a head away third. Bank Note, -Sagittarius, King's Folly, Dimmer and Kilmezzo, nearly in line, were next.
